Output 61a558e98ef034b53099bf93ee82a42d5ab75894afd8fe3686c87240d38eea97:0

value
94960850
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5af23929739bf7b5a99670bc61cee3515e18b46e OP_EQUALVERIFY OP_CHECKSIG
address
19HszEZodE8HE23SD18TzwvoG415h7phpy
transaction
61a558e98ef034b53099bf93ee82a42d5ab75894afd8fe3686c87240d38eea97
spent
true